    7 Clean Home Benefits for a Healthier Lifestyle

    Rhys GregoryBy Rhys GregoryJuly 21, 2024Updated:July 21, 2024No Comments
    Share Facebook Twitter Copy Link LinkedIn Email WhatsApp
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email Copy Link

    Home is the crucial part of our lives where we spend most of our time. While we think about the home’s overall appeal, we often forget its cleanliness for a healthier lifestyle. A neat and tidy home offers innumerable health benefits. A healthy home makes our life happy and healthy. Beyond this, a clean home is a source of the following seven health benefits:

    1. Reduces no. of Germs 

    When we focus on home cleanliness, we wipe away germs and bacteria. Germs are more prevalent on kitchen countertops, switchboards, doorknobs, toilets, and other surfaces. Moreover, various household appliances have germs, clean all these areas, and reduce the chances of getting sick with colds, flu, and other illnesses. 

    2. Better Quality of Air

    There are usually three factors that reduce the quality of the air: dust, pet dander, and pollen. These particles build up in your house and cause asthma and allergies. While cleaning your home, these particles are removed and make it easier to breathe. To improve the air quality of your home, vacuum your carpets, dust shelves, and change air filters. 

    3. Reduces Stress and Provides Relaxation

    A clutter-free home is a source of relaxation, while a messy home always makes you overwhelmed and anxious. So, when you tidy up and cleanse your home, it will unwind the feelings of anxiety and stress.  Spend some time each day to pick the toy pieces of your kids, separate the clothes from washed and unwashed, and organize your home.

    4. Improves the Quality of Sleep

    A clean home and a clean bedroom will help you fall asleep better. A messy room will make it harder to relax. So spend some time cleaning your home and declutter your space to create a calm atmosphere. Always tidy up your room before bedtime. Make it a routine, and you can enjoy a good night’s sleep.     5. Boosts Your Productivity

    The space around us influences our productivity, so a clean, organized space increases our productivity. When everything is in its place, it becomes easy to access what you want, ultimately leading you to get your work done. You won’t have to look for waste items and do not need to get distracted by the mess around you. A clean room and place will make it easier to do homework, prepare dinner, and spend family time without distractions. 

    6. Gives Healthy Eating Habits

    A clean cooking area will inspire you to adopt healthy eating habits. When your kitchen is neat and clean, the preparation of healthy meals and snacks will become easy, as fewer germs will stick to the cooking objects. Moreover, you will like to cook at home rather than eat out, and it will save you a lot of money as well. You can cleanse your kitchen by washing dishes, wiping countertops, and organizing your pantry. 

    7. Eliminates Pests from Home

    A clean home will prevent pests such as ants, cockroaches, and mice. These pests are usually found near food crumbs and spills, so a clean and disinfected kitchen will not offer this kind of pests. Clean up the mess in your kitchen and store food properly to eliminate unwanted pests. Take out the trash regularly, which will keep your home tidy and prevent pests. 

    Easy-to-Follow Tips to Clean Your Home 

    Here are some easy-to-follow tips and tricks to clean your home in less time for a healthier lifestyle, as these tips will make the process time-saving. 

    1.  Schedule the Cleaning Process

    Decide and dedicate the time to clean your home weekly.  Vacuum and dust, and do laundry properly. 

    2.  Involve the Kids and the Whole Family

    Cleaning is a fun and great activity for kids to get involved. You can engage them with yourself to clean the home with you. Assign them small tasks and work together to build a clean home. 

    3. Declutter Regularly

    Get rid of useless items because sometimes, we keep things just because we think we might need them in the future, which can make a lot of mess. So, decide which things need to be kept and which do not.  

    4. Clean and Clean

    After cleaning, throw away the wipes in bins, wipe down the countertops after preparing meals, and do a quick cleanup after bed.

    5. Use the Efficient Tools

    The right tools, such as microfiber cloths, a good vacuum machine, and natural cleaning products, make the cleaning process easier and save time. 

    6. Disinfect High-Touch Areas

    The frequently touched areas, such as door knobs and electric appliances such as refrigerators, ovens, etc, light switches, and countertops, should be cleaned and disinfected regularly. 

    7. Set Small and Achievable Goals

    Never try to clean the whole house in a single day. Break down the cleaning process into small and manageable steps and clean one area at a time, such as one day for the bedroom and so on.

    Conclusion

    A clean home offers various benefits and improves the health and overall well-being of your loved ones. It reduces germs and allergens and creates a productive environment for them. So, from today,  clean, disinfect, and declutter your home for a healthier and joyous life.
